There are some rules to keep in mind. You can only do tax-loss harvesting in your taxable brokerage accounts—not in 401(k)s or IRAs. You have to use short-term losses to offset short-term gains and long-term losses to offset long-term gains, but if you have excess losses in either category, they can be applied to either type of gain.

Even if you're in a high tax bracket, it's important not to just focus on taxes when you're selecting funds. A fund with a return of 10% and a 3% tax bite is still going to leave you with more than a fund with a 5% return and a 1% tax burden. After-tax return figures help you keep this total picture in mind.

What is the value of tax-loss harvesting? Examining more than 80,000 investors, Vanguard analysts demonstrate that outcomes of equity-based tax-loss harvesting vary significantly across investor characteristics and market environments. The expected results range from no benefit or even negative returns to gains of more than 1% annually.You don't have to pay taxes on that first $50,000. Here, stocks with losses are sold when capital gains from profitable trades are realized, thus reducing the net tax liability.How it works What’s tax-loss harvesting? Tax-loss harvesting involves selling an investment that has experienced a loss and replacing that investment with a diferent holding designed to maintain your asset allocation.
